SPONSOR/ GODPARENT:
Your sponsor/godparent becomes your spiritual guide throughout the preparation time and continues that support for a lifetime. He or she must be 16 years of age or older, have received ALL Sacraments of Initiation in the Catholic Church (Baptism, Eucharist, and Confirmation). A sponsor should be leading a life in harmony with the faith and the role to be undertaken. If your sponsor/godparent is married, they must be married in the Catholic Church. It is important that the sponsor chosen is a person who is willing to share their faith experiences, pray with, and be an active part of your child's faith journey. It is also helpful if your sponsor/godparent lives in the area so that you can get together easily. If the sponsor lives out of town, you will be asked to choose a responsible adult to serve as a faith partner, carrying out the duties of sponsor/godparent during the preparation period. The sponsor/godparent and the candidate need not be of the same sex; however, Canon Law prohibits a parent from being their Child's sponsor/godparent. Canon Law also states that a sponsor/godparent must not be bound by any canonical penalty legitimately imposed or declared. In short, your sponsor/godparent should be a Catholic in good standing with whom you will have an ongoing relationship. Please have your sponsor/godparent fill out the attached form. SERVICE
Because the Gospel message involves reaching out to others and because in completing our initiation as Catholics we become full members of the Church, we are called to serve one another. If we complete our initiation with no experience of reaching out and sharing the Gospel message, then the idea of what it means to be a Catholic-Christian is lacking. Various meaningful opportunities are available throughout the parish and civic community. Each family is encouraged to participate in a community service project together. We encourage the candidate to be involved in projects that are both of interest, meaningful to them, and needed in the community.
